CaptainCougar (4663), Rockville, Maryland, USA Dec 15, 2007 Pours a transparent bright golden with a frothy well-lacing white head. Aroma of lightly sweet biscuity Belgian and pale malts. Starts fairly full, complex and biscuity sweet with a nice light fruity complexity and mild coriander. Smooth, mild bitterness throughout. Very true to style and enjoyable, a nice abbey tripel. hopscotch (4579), Vero Beach, Florida, USA Sep 11, 2008 Bottle... RBSG ‘08... Cloudy yellow ale with a small white head. Good retention.
